Bo Horvat Lights Up His Olympic First with Islanders Goal Debut

February 12, 2026 1 Min Read
Share
SHARE

New York Islanders captain Bo Horvat made a notable debut at the Milan-Cortina Olympics. During Canada’s initial game against the Czech Republic, he scored a crucial goal that put Canada ahead 3-0. The play started with Dallas Stars defenseman Thomas Hurley making a quick pass to Florida Panthers forward Brad Marchand. Marchand then fed the puck to Horvat, who maneuvered through the Czech defense and scored past Anaheim Ducks goalie Lukas Dostal into the net’s five-hole.

Earlier in the game, Horvat also accidentally hit a high stick right before the first period ended, which required some repair work. Among the Islanders, Horvat is one of just two players representing Canada at the Olympics, and he is scheduled to face Czech forward Ondrej Palat later in the tournament.
